How they compare
South Africa currently reports 27.9% against 26.2% in Panama, a difference of 1.7%.
That makes South Africa's figure about 1.1 times Panama's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 6 shared years of data; in 2010 it was South Africa ahead.
Panama ranks 30th and South Africa ranks 28th of 40 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Panama averaged higher in 1 and South Africa in 1.
